You would have to know what the translation is
e.g. suppose we have the translation (x,y) -----> (x+2,y-1)
and you had a triangle A(4,5), B(-2,9) and C(0,0)
then the translated triangle would be
A'(6,4) , B'(0,8) and C'(2,-1)
